A rectangle has a perimeter of 160 cm. Its breadth is 40%
less than its length. Calculate the area (in cm²) of a square whose side is 20 cm shorter than the length of the rectangle.Solution
ATQ,
Let the length of the rectangle be '5y' cm
Breadth of the rectangle = (3/5) × 5y = '3y' cm
So, 2 × (5y + 3y) = 160
Or, 8y = 80
Or, 'y' = 10
Length of rectangle = 5 × 10 = 50 cm
Side of the square = 50 - 20 = 30 cm
Therefore, area of the square = (side)² = 30² = 900 cm²
